Ideal.krullDimLE_zero_quotient_iff_forall_minimalPrimes_isMaximal
∀ {R : Type u_2} [inst : CommRing R] {I : Ideal R}, Ring.KrullDimLE 0 (R ⧸ I) ↔ ∀ J ∈ I.minimalPrimes, J.IsMaximalA quotient R ⧸ I has krull dimension at most zero if and only if all minimal primes over I
are maximal.
